Re-opening for oxide as it turns out APP_PKGNAME is not an environment
variable that is being set anywhere for click apps. According to
https://developer.ubuntu.com/en/phone/platform/guides/app-confinement/,
its value can be inferred like this:
APP_PKGNAME = APP_ID.split('_')[0]
